Selection of high-quality MOS tubes and capacitors to ensure reliability and long life.</div><br/><p>Parameter:<br/>Charging voltage: DC36V<br/>Over-charging protection, over-discharge protection, over-current protection, output short-circuit protection<br/>Maximum working current: 30AMAX<br/>Continuous discharge current: 20A MAX<br/>Over-discharge protection voltage: 2.6V<br/>Overcharge protection voltage: 4.25V<br/>Charging current:20A MAX<br/>Equalizing charging function Equalizing voltage 4.2V<br/>Temperature Protection: Discharge High Temperature 75℃; Charge Low Temperature -7℃.<br/>Applicable Battery Types: 3.7V Ternary Battery Lithium Cobalt, Lithium Manganese Battery</p><p>Wiring steps:<br/>(1) Capture the row of wires connected to each section of the battery to ensure that the row of wires are effectively connected. Ensure that the plug end of the row of wires, a single potential order sequentially increasing or sequentially decreasing. The order of potentials is consistent with the order of potentials in the socket at the end of the protection board and the potentials are one-to-one correspondence.<br/>(2) Solder the B- lead of the protection board to the total negative B- of the battery pack. Ensure that the welding point is firm and reliable and good conductive properties, alignment position without extrusion, friction and other possible hazards, alignment smooth and short. Avoid solder, easily conductive objects or leads falling into, sticking to or touching inside the protection board.<br/>(3) Match the plug of the alignment cable with the socket of the protection board. First of all, complete the protection board B- lead welding to the total negative B- of the battery pack, and then the plug of the row of wires and the socket of the protection board docking, to ensure that the plug of the row of wires and the socket of the protection board in place, no electrically charged objects or leads to contact with the protection board, and to do a good job of fixing measures.<br/>(4) B+ and C- are connected to the positive and negative terminals of the charging connector respectively. Ensure that in the process of soldering the connection, the isolation of other leads is done well to avoid short-circuiting. The battery pack voltage of the discharge port and charging port is consistent with the battery pack voltage, the correct polarity and the correct wiring position.<br/>Note: the same port charging and discharging share a negative C-, only one lead wire, charging/discharging MOS is appearing in pairs, the same board charging current and discharging current is as large.</p><p>Package include:<br/>Lithium battery protection board *1<br/>Acquisition cable *1<br/></p></div></div><br/>
